Cost of Living in Weitchpec, CA: What You Need to Know

With a cost of living index of 96, Weitchpec, CA is slightly more affordable than average. Living here is 4% cheaper than the national average and 48% below the California state average of 144. Weitchpec is a small community of 87 residents.

The median household income in Weitchpec is $53,125, which is 29% lower than the national median of $75,149.

Climate is another factor for anyone considering a move to Weitchpec. The area sees an average annual temperature of 52.5°F, with summers averaging 57°F and winters around 48°F. Annual rainfall totals 46.1 inches spread over roughly 153 days.
